>        I do not see two important things in the configuration you posted:
>
> 1 - No context where the call is received
> 2 - No channel => 1-15,17-31
>
>        Also, when I connect to a PBX I usually do:
>
> mfcr2_max_ani=0
> mfcr2_max_dnis=30
>
>        This is because most PBX systems will not send out ANI and I use the
> DNIS as the dialed number.

> > I'm trying to connect an Asterisk with an Avaya Definity via MFC R2,
> > all the channels are up, but when Asterisk receive a call from Avaya
> > only appears this message un the CLI:
> >
> >
> > New MFC/R2 call detected on chan 22.
> >
> >
> > And nothing happens, when hang up the call appears this message in the
> > CLI:
> >
> >
> > Chan 22 - Far end disconnected. Reason: Normal Clearing
> > MFC/R2 call disconnected on channel 22
> > MFC/R2 call end on channel 22
> >
> >
> >
> >
> > I'm using:
> > Ubuntu Server 10.04 LST
> > Libpri 1.4.11.2
> > Dahdi-linux-complete-2.3.0.1+2.3.0
> > openr2-1.3.0
> > asterisk-1.6.2.8
> >
> >
> >
> >
> > This is the configuration that has the Asterisk:
> >
> >
> > chan_dahdi.conf
> >
> >
> > [trunkgroups]
> >
> >
> > [channels]
> > usecallerid=yes
> > callwaiting=yes
> > usecallingpres=yes
> > callwaitingcallerid=yes
> > threewaycalling=yes
> > transfer=yes
> > canpark=yes
> > cancallforward=yes
> > callreturn=yes
> > echocancel=yes
> > echocancelwhenbridged=yes
> >
> >
> > signalling=mfcr2
> > mfcr2_variant=mx
> > mfcr2_get_ani_first=no
> > mfcr2_max_ani=20
> > mfcr2_max_dnis=4
> > mfcr2_category=national_subscriber
> > mfcr2_logdir=span1
> > mfcr2_logging=all
> > group=0
> > callgroup=0
> > pickupgroup=0
> >
> >
> >
> >
> >
> >
> > system.conf
> >
> >
> > # Span 1: WCT1/0 "Wildcard TE122 Card 0" (MASTER)
> > span=1,0,0,cas,hdb3
> > # termtype: te
> > cas=1-15:1101
> > cas=17-31:1101
> > dchan=16
> > echocanceller=oslec,1-15,17-31
> >
> >
> > # Global data
> >
> >
> > loadzone        = mx
> > defaultzone     = mx
> >
> >
> >
> >
> > Anyone had any experience like this.
